问题描述
我有一个正在横向模式下进行的活动。我提示具有以下设置的对话框:
@Override public void onResume() {
super.onResume();
//lock screen to portrait
listener = (Form_SearchPagelistener) mContext;
getActivity().set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_PORTRAIT);
}
@Override public void onPause() {
super.onPause();
//set rotation to sensor dependent
listener = (Form_SearchPagelistener) mContext;
getActivity().set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_FULL_SENSOR);
}
这确实将对话框锁定为纵向模式,但是一旦我处于横向状态(我的父母活动),我只会得到黑屏,直到垂直旋转设备。当我处于垂直模式下的父级活动时,效果很好。
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)